def testindexes(self): "Histogram: indexes" histogram = self._histogram #test self.assertVectorEqual( histogram.indexes( (0.5, 1) ), (0,0) ) self.assertVectorEqual( histogram.indexes( (0.5, 99) ), (0,2) ) self.assertVectorEqual( histogram.indexes( (1.1, 3) ), (1,1) ) return
def testTranspose(self): "Histogram: transpose" histogram = self._histogram print "before transpose: %s" % histogram histogram = histogram.transpose() print "after transpose: %s" % histogram self.assertVectorEqual( histogram.indexes( (1, 0.5) ), (0,0) ) self.assertVectorEqual( histogram.indexes( (99, 0.5) ), (2,0) ) self.assertVectorEqual( histogram.indexes( (3, 1.1) ), (1,1) ) return
def testTranspose(self): "Histogram: transpose" histogram = self._histogram print("before transpose: %s" % histogram) histogram = histogram.transpose() print("after transpose: %s" % histogram) self.assertVectorEqual( histogram.indexes( (1, 0.5) ), (0,0) ) self.assertVectorEqual( histogram.indexes( (99, 0.5) ), (2,0) ) self.assertVectorEqual( histogram.indexes( (3, 1.1) ), (1,1) ) return